I'm very satisfied with my AT&T Tilt and have no desire to purchase a new phone any time soon. I pre-ordered one of the first batches of Tilts and I must say that I'm pretty satisfied with how long the original battery has held up. As a matter of fact, it still works, it just doesn't hold a charge for long enough especially with the abuse I put my phone through.
I mutilate and torture my cell phone on a daily basis. I do not sit at a desk all day and move around all day long and I like to listen to news / talk shows / audiobooks while I go about my business. Most of the time during the day I'm streaming some sort of media over the internet on my phone. I used to carry a pocket radio with me but since I realized I can listen to any radio station in the world over the internet on my phone I have since completely switched to using my phone all of the time.
My old battery would last about 2 hours (not bad) during the course of the day. I would compensate by carrying mobile battery packs around with me to charge the phone while it was in my pocket as well as a regular charger to plug it into the wall if I had the chance and I would make it through the day with a live phone about half the time. I bought this battery not hoping to go for days without charging but just to make it through one workday of abuse.
I have 2 complaints. #1, the oversized backing that comes with this battery that you have to use in order to use the oversized battery is not stable. It constantly pops off even when I'm not messing with the phone. Fortunately, the battery doesn't seem to come out of it's socket even when the backing comes off so it's not a killer issue, but it is very annoying. I may even switch back to the old battery just to alleviate this problem. #2 is that for a battery that is more than twice the capacity of the original battery on top of being brand new, it doesn't hold an impressive charge. It does last longer than I remember the original battery lasting, but I have doubts as to whether or not it even lasts twice as long as the original.
It does do what I wanted it to do though. I can make it through the day with a live phone. At the end of the day now I usually end up having about 30% of the battery left and since my phone stays alive longer I am using it more so it is handling an increased load.
I would suggest trying the standard sized extended life battery before trying this one, while personally I don't mind the extra size of the phone the backing is very annoying and the life of the battery just doesn't knock my socks off.
